Rebuilding Your Mental Architecture
This isn't motivation. It's structured psychological work, anchored in two proprietary frameworks I've developed over fifteen years of in-the-room work with elite performers.THE T.O.P MODEL — DIAGNOSTICMaps performance breakdown to one of three architectural layers:T — Technical. Skill automation under pressure. Is the work deeply enough trained to survive cognitive narrowing?O — Outside. Environmental factors loading the system. Sleep debt, role ambiguity, social pressure, conditions.P — Psychological. Threat appraisal, identity fusion, attention architecture.Most performance work goes straight to Psychological. The actual leak is usually Technical or Outside — with Psychological as downstream consequence.Misdiagnosis is the most expensive mistake in performance work. The T.O.P Model fixes that first.THE 5-SYSTEM MENTAL ARCHITECTURE — STRUCTURALEvery operator has five systems that can leak under load:Pressure · Identity · Recovery · Confidence · FocusThe 5-System maps exactly where you're leaking — and what to rebuild first.HOW WE WORK TOGETHER
